在数字货币与区块链技术迅速发展的今天,MetaMask作为一种流行的方法,让用户能够方便地管理他们的加密资产和与去...
MetaMask 是一个流行的加密货币钱包和区块链浏览器扩展,广泛使用于以太坊及其支持的网络。它不仅允许用户管理他们的加密资产,还能与去中心化应用(DApp)进行交互。在这个过程中,MetaMask 如何处理节点数据和连接到以太坊网络是许多人不太了解的关键问题。本篇文章将详细介绍 MetaMask 节点的工作原理,其在加密货币生态系统中的角色,以及如何其使用体验。
MetaMask 是一个去中心化的浏览器扩展,用户通过它可以在与区块链进行交易时保持匿名与安全。MetaMask 本质上充当用户浏览器与区块链(如以太坊)节点之间的桥梁。用户可以使用 MetaMask 创建一个钱包,管理多个以太坊地址,并且通过它进行加密货币交易。 MetaMask 节点主要充当信息中心,用户通过它向区块链网络发送交易请求,接收网络状态更新。同时,MetaMask 还允许用户与智能合约进行交互,增强了用户的区块链体验。 技术上,MetaMask 可以连接到不同的网络节点,包括公共节点、私有节点或自托管节点。用户可以根据需求切换节点,以实现更快的交易确认或更高的隐私保护。
近年来,去中心化应用(DApp)如雨后春笋般出现,涉及金融、游戏、社交网络等多个领域。MetaMask 在这些应用中扮演着至关重要的角色,作为用户与区块链之间的中介。事实上,MetaMask 是连接 DApp 和用户钱包的桥梁,确保用户能够安全、便捷地进行操作。 通过 MetaMask,用户可以轻松地向 DApp 发送交易请求,比如抵押、借贷、质押等操作。DApp 开发者需要确保他们的应用程序能够与 MetaMask 进行良好的集成,这通常需要调用 MetaMask 提供的 API,以便让用户在应用中直接进行钱包操作。
为了增强用户体验,MetaMask 提供了一些策略,比如网络切换、私有节点支持等。用户可以根据自己的需求选择不同的网络。例如,如果用户需要更快的交易确认时间,可以选择连接到节点响应更迅速的网络。 此外,MetaMask 允许用户在私有节点上创建自定义 RPC 连接,这在一些企业级解决方案中尤为重要。通过连接到专有节点,公司能够确保交易的高效处理和数据的隐私保护。 用户在使用 MetaMask 时,应该定期更新扩展版本,以确保拥有最新的功能和安全性。保持钱包的私钥和助记词的安全也至关重要,用户需避免在不安全的环境下进行敏感操作。
对于加密货币用户而言,安全性是一个相当重要的话题。MetaMask 的安全机制包括私钥的本地存储、助记词的生成和密码保护等。用户的私钥从未离开用户的设备,这意味着只有用户对其资产拥有控制权。然而,这也要求用户对自己的操作非常谨慎。 除了本地安全,用户在使用 MetaMask 时也需注意钓鱼攻击,这种攻击通常发生在假冒网站,他们试图获取用户的私钥或助记词。用户应确保在官方渠道下载 MetaMask,并仔细检查网站 URL,以避免陷入钓鱼骗局。 另外,使用硬件钱包(如 Ledger 或 Trezor)与 MetaMask 结合使用,可以进一步确保资产安全。硬件钱包通过离线保存私钥,提供了一层额外的保护,使用户的资产更安全。
随着区块链技术的发展和生态系统的成熟,MetaMask 作为一个重要的工具,也在不断演进。未来,我们可能会看到更多集成的功能,比如提供更复杂的 DeFi 工具、更完善的交易分析等。 另外,MetaMask 也正在探索其他区块链的兼容性,可能会支持更多的链,以吸引更广泛的用户群体。这将使得用户不仅能在以太坊上进行操作,还能在其他链如 Polkadot、Solana 甚至是 Layer 2 解决方案中进行交互。 用户教育也是未来 MetaMask 发展的重要方向。随着区块链技术的复杂性增加,MetaMask 可能会推出更多教学资源,帮助用户更好地理解如何安全地使用钱包,如何选择合适的网络节点,以及如何进行高级操作。
1. MetaMask是什么,它是如何工作的? 2. 如何在MetaMask中管理多个钱包? 3. 使用MetaMask与去中心化应用的安全性如何? 4. MetaMask节点的选择对交易速度的影响? 5. MetaMask可能面临哪些安全风险,又如何防范?
MetaMask 是一个去中心化的加密钱包,主要用于管理以太坊及其相关代币。用户可以通过浏览器插件轻松访问区块链,同时与去中心化应用(DApp)进行交互。MetaMask 通过连接到以太坊节点来实现这一点,节点可以是公共的、私有的或用户自建的。 当用户需要进行交易时,MetaMask 会将请求发送到指定的节点,并获取交易结果。节点会验证交易、计算 gas 费,并将结果返回给用户。这一过程是快速和透明的,用户可以通过 MetaMask 直接看到自己的交易状态和余额。 除了基本的交易功能,MetaMask 还集成了关键的安全特性,例如助记词生成和私钥本地存储。这样,用户可以安全地通过设备访问他们的资产。
在 MetaMask 中管理多个钱包是一个相对简单的过程。用户可以通过创建不同的账户来管理不同的钱包,每个账户都可以持有独立的资产。此外,用户还可以导入现有的以太坊地址和相应的私钥。 要创建新账户,用户只需单击扩展程序中的"账户"选项,并选择"创建账户"。用户可以为每个账户命名,方便区分。创建完成后,用户可以在不同账户之间切换,管理不同的钱包资产。 此外,MetaMask 还支持通过导入助记词来恢复钱包。用户只需在"导入账户"选项中输入助记词,MetaMask 将创建与之对应的钱包,并让用户访问其中的资产。
与去中心化应用(DApp)交互时,MetaMask 提供了多层安全性。首先,MetaMask 保证用户的私钥是在本地存储的,这意味着私钥不会在网络上传输,从而减少被黑客攻击的风险。 其次,当用户访问 DApp 时,MetaMask 会请求用户确认交易的详细信息,包括接收地址、转账金额和所需的 gas 费。用户在确认交易之前,可以完全查看所有信息,从而降低碰到恶意应用的风险。 此外,MetaMask 图标会提示用户当前连接的网络,让用户能够随时注意自己是否在安全的网络操作。用户应避免在不安全的 Wi-Fi 环境中使用 DApp,以确保数据不被攻击者窃取。 然而,MetaMask 仍然面临一些安全风险,例如针对用户的钓鱼攻击。用户需要保持警惕,确保只在官方 DApp 和信任的网站上进行操作,避免下载不明的扩展程序和APP。
MetaMask 允许用户选择连接的节点,这直接影响到交易速度与效率。不同的节点在性能上的差异可能导致用户在进行交易时遇到延迟。 一般来说,连接到响应迅速且稳定的节点会带来更快的交易确认时间。很多用户选择连接公有的以太坊节点(如 Infura 或 Alchemy),这些节点经过,能够处理大量的请求;但在网络拥堵的情况下,它们可能会变得缓慢和不可靠。 如果用户对交易速度有极高的要求,建议使用自托管节点。虽然自托管节点的搭建和维护需要一定的技术知识,但用户能保证交易不会受到网络波动的影响。 此外,在 MetaMask 中启用链上交易历史数据的查询也会加速用户对交易状况的了解,这样可以更快做出反应。在网络繁忙时,提前选择低拥堵时段进行交易也会提高速度。
MetaMask 虽然提供了多重安全措施,但仍面临一些潜在的安全风险,主要包括钓鱼攻击、恶意应用和网络漏洞。 钓鱼攻击是最常见的风险之一,攻击者可能伪造 MetaMask 的界面,当用户输入私钥或助记词时进行窃取。防范这一风险的最好方法是确保只在信任的网站进行操作,并检查 URL 是否正确。此外,用户绝不应该在社交媒体或无关网站上透露任何与其钱包相关的敏感信息。 恶意 DApp 也是潜在的威胁,用户在进行交易时,需仔细审查 DApp 的信誉,以避免资产损失。通常应该选择使用知名或有良好声誉的 DApp。 最后,用户应时常更新 MetaMask 的版本,以确保拥有最新的安全补丁。启用双因素身份验证(如果可用)也是增强安全性的有效方法,通过额外的安全步骤来保护钱包。 总而言之,用户在使用 MetaMask 进行任何操作时需保持警觉与谨慎,确保自身资产的安全。
总结来说,MetaMask 作为一个连接用户与去中心化网络的工具,极大地方便了人们在区块链上的操作。了解其工作原理、节点选择、安全性等方面,能够帮助用户更好地使用这一工具,最大化地增强他们的区块链体验。希望本文对你了解 MetaMask 节点有帮助!